Elon Musk said on social media that federal employees will be given another chance to recap their work last week or be fired, contradicting guidance from the Office of Personnel Management.

Musk made the comment in response to a post on X, which he owns, calling for employees who did not respond to the email to be fired. Advertisement

“Subject to the discretion of the president, they will be given another chance,” Musk wrote. “Failure to respond a second time will result in termination.”

OPM, however, on Monday said that it informed agencies that employee responding to the email is voluntary and clarified to agencies that “a non-response to the email does not equate to a resignation” following a meeting of the Chief Human Capital Officers Council.

The dueling statements left many federal agencies and employees confused as to follow Musk’s directives of explaining their five accomplishments or what it even means if they did comply on Monday.

The confusion appeared during the run from department to department. Health and Human Services staff were first told to reply but by Sunday told the “pause” until given further instructions and then a third email on Monday saying that not responding would not impact their jobs. Advertisement

The issue started on Saturday when Musk, serving as a special government employee working with the Department of Government Efficiency, warned that all federal employees to account for their prior week’s work or lose their jobs.
